IESG Processing Time Statistics

Document got to the AD/IESG on 2004-01-26 and was approved on 2004-06-07.

According to the speculative analysis, the document waited for AD 0 days, previous AD 6 days, authors 52 days, and others 73 days, a total of 131 days, and was revised 0 times.

The (last) responsible AD for this document was Hollenbeck_Scott.

Overall Processing Time Statistics

Document was in individual and WG process for 300 days, and in IESG/RFC Editor process for 252 days, 552 days in total. This is 1 years and 6 months.
